Wanted My Own Tomato Basil Soup step by step
-
I start by adding Olive Oil to my pan.. I have a cast iron I luv using. Dice up your Garlic Cloves (if you dont have garlic cloves use dry garlic) this isnt to put you out, it's just to warm the soul. And in that case, dice your onions.and celery, add to the pan, this is where you add your dry herbs And spices. We are going to season our onions. Amd add soya sauce just a sprinkle, it adds a nice salt flavour to the onions. Its incredible the flavour you can get from them..
-
Your seasoning salt, garlic oregano, And dry basil.. I always keep a cup of water beside my stove. I add some to my pan, top my pan w a lid, steam slightly. Onions are different during break down. They dont break down straight up as easily..
-
Open your tomatoes, And find a nice big pot, lets go. Add your tomatoes to the pot. (If you have fresh tomatoes to use this is where Ithe suggest dicing them, And add them to your frying pan, getting a nice cook on them first. Add salt to them not a lot just flavour..
-
Turn the stove on low to start, so as no to burn your tomatoes. Once your pans finished, add it to the pot..
-
Chop up your fresh Basil leaves. **I am not particular. Also I chop up the stems which you can eat or remove after leave them..
-
So youll be able to remove them. Mix well,gently. Turn you tomatoes up slowly, I add the milk in whilst the tomatoes are still cold. Same w the cream, (if you choose to use cream) its still very yummy w just milk.. add your basil.. add some more dry basil if you choose to… i season to preference, so its not always exactly a tsp..
-
Tidbit** I have also shredded carrots for this soup. Mmm but I really like when I add peppers… I will have to upload my "Roasted Pepper and Tomato soup".
-
Turn up let boil, try to gently simmer your diced tomatoes. Adding some salt And pepper. I add a small pinch of cayenne during this sonit can simmer into the soup itself. I start small, to each their own on **heat ๐.
-
I usually turn the stove down by this point, its been approx 15 to 20mins. And simmer slowly for another 15 -30 this all depends how you feel about temperature on your stove. How you like your flavours blend, And come together. Then I take a masher and crush all the tomatoes, and so they are still pieces but not entirely..
-
So I add parmesan or mozzarella cheese on top w a serving as well, a dollop of either ricotta or sour cream in the centre. Adds a different definition of flavours. Mm.
-
Hopefully I havent missed anything and its easy to understand.. Enjoy. Great for a cold day its a nice thick creamy tomato.
